The restoration of a 1969 Triumph T150T Trident 750cc presents an opportunity to breathe new life into a monumental piece of motorcycling history. As a running project, this Trident exemplifies Triumph's foray into the realm of multi-cylinder performance, marking a significant era in the evolution of motorcycle engineering. The T150T Trident, with its distinctive three-cylinder engine, is a testament to the innovative spirit that defined Triumph in the late 1960s.
